Description of OM3 Fiber Patch Cords
"OM" stands for optical multi-mode, which is the standard for multimode optical fiber to indicate the fiber grade.
Comparison of OM1, OM2, OM3, and OM4 Fiber Parameters and Specifications
1. OM1 refers to 50µm or 62.5µm core multimode fiber with a full injection bandwidth of 200/500MHz/km or greater at 850/1300nm.
2. OM2 refers to 50µm or 62.5µm core multimode fiber with a full injection bandwidth of 500/500MHz/km or greater at 850/1300nm.
3. OM3 is an 850nm laser-optimized, 50µm core multimode fiber. In 10Gb/s Ethernet using an 850nm VCSEL, the fiber can transmit up to 300m.
4. OM4 is an upgraded version of OM3 multimode fiber, with a transmission distance of up to 550m.

FAQ
When should I use OM3 Fiber Patch Cords?
OM3 fiber is designed for use with VCSELs. It complies with the ISO/IEC 11801-2nd OM-3 fiber specification and meets the requirements of 10 Gigabit Ethernet applications. OM3 fiber comes in a variety of types, including indoor and indoor/outdoor options, with fiber counts ranging from 4 to 48 fibers. It also supports all applications based on legacy multimode 50/125 fiber, including LED and laser light sources.
1. OM3 fiber systems can extend the transmission distance of Gigabit Ethernet up to 900 meters, eliminating the need for expensive laser components for inter-building distances exceeding 550 meters.
2. Standard 62.5/125μm multimode fiber can be used for all applications within the OC-12 (622 Mb/s) speed range within a 2000-meter range. For all other scenarios, single-mode fiber is used. However, the emergence of OM3 multimode fiber has changed this situation. Because OM3 fiber can extend the transmission distance of Gigabit and 10 Gigabit systems, using 850nm wavelength optical modules in conjunction with VCSELs will be the most cost-effective cabling solution.
3. When link lengths exceed 1000 meters, single-mode fiber is still the only option. Single-mode fiber can achieve a transmission distance of 5 kilometers at a 1310nm wavelength in Gigabit systems and 10 kilometers in 10 Gigabit systems.
4. When link lengths are less than or equal to 1000 meters, OM3 50μm multimode fiber can be used in Gigabit systems, while single-mode fiber should be used in 10 Gigabit systems.
5. When link lengths are less than 300 meters, OM3 Fiber Patch Cords can be used in all Gigabit and 10 Gigabit systems.
